LINUX.ORG.RU

QBookShelf 1.0pre1 релиз!


0

0

"Книжная Полка", а именно так звучит название программы в переводе (если отбросить букву Q), призвана помочь Вам при чтении и организации электронных книг под операционной системой Линукс. В данной версии программы присутствуют все необходимые функции для более-менее удобного чтения электронных книг. Их, конечно, ещё мало, но к версии 2.0 будут вырисовываться уже стоящие плюсы. Также к вышеупомянутой версии (2.0) в программу будет встроена "Библиотека" для организации и хранения электронных текстов.



Что представляет из себя сейчас данная программа?
"Книжная Полка" уже сейчас прекрасно справляется с некоторыми своими обязанностями:

Показ текста - программа спокойно отображает файлы больших размеров, различных форматов: будь то html, обыкновенный текстовый файл или MS WORD DOC! В скором
времени будет возможен показ текстов в формате OpenOffice/StarOffice SXW.
Сохранение текущей позиции при чтении ( возможно два типа сохранения позиции: Первый: Сохранение позиции с использованием номера текущего параграфа и Второй: Сохранение текущей позиции курсора ? возможен только тогда, когда вы нажали где-нибудь в рабочей области. На сегодняшний день пользователи программы предпочитают пользоваться первым типом сохранения позиции).
Увеличение \ уменьшение текста.
Печать текста.
Поддержка нескольких текстовых кодировок: KOI8-R, CodePage-1251, UTF-8 и DOS 866.
Поиск по тексту.
Гибкие настройки программы (шрифты, цвета и тд...).
Полноэкранный/оконный режим.
Перевод всего текста из верхнего регистра в нижний и наоборот.
Режим редактора (довольно-таки полезная вещь, если вам нужно что-либо подправить в тексте).
Автоматический текстовый режим (определяет какой файл был открыт ? текстовый, html или MS doc).
Форматирование содержания html-файлов.
Полная локализация программы (пока только английский язык и русский язык).
Автоматический скроллинг текста.
Автоопределение кодировок.
Постраничный скроллинг.
Фоновое изображение.

И теперь самый большой плюс для нелюбителей КДЕ - программа написана на QT поэтому вам не надо иметь установленную библиотеку среды КДЕ!

>>> Подробности



Проверено: l-xoid ()

Ответ на: Re: QBookShelf 1.0pre1 релиз! от Selecter

Re: Re: QBookShelf 1.0pre1 релиз!

$qmake qbookshelf.pro
$make

На #make install выдаёт следующее:

( [ -d src ] && cd src ; grep "^qmake_all:" Makefile && make -f Makefile qmake_all; ) || true
( [ -d src ] && cd src ; make -f Makefile install; ) || true
make[1]: Entering directory `/home/anton/aaaaaaaaaaaaa/qbookshelf-1.0pre1/src'
make[1]: Nothing to be done for `install'.
make[1]: Leaving directory `/home/anton/aaaaaaaaaaaaa/qbookshelf-1.0pre1/src'

Selecter ★★★★ ()
Ответ на: Re: Re: QBookShelf 1.0pre1 релиз! от Selecter

Re: Re: Re: QBookShelf 1.0pre1 релиз!

На #make install выдаёт следующее:

( [ -d src ] && cd src ; grep "^qmake_all:" Makefile && make -f Makefile qmake_all; ) || true
( [ -d src ] && cd src ; make -f Makefile install; ) || true
make[1]: Entering directory `/home/anton/aaaaaaaaaaaaa/qbookshelf-1.0pre1/src'
make[1]: Nothing to be done for `install'.
make[1]: Leaving directory `/home/anton/aaaaaaaaaaaaa/qbookshelf-1.0pre1/src'


Селектер, там же в папке есть скрипт install, которым и нужно устанавливать программу!

Также заметь, что это pre1 версия

Severus_Zley ()

Re: QBookShelf 1.0pre1 релиз!

Очень интересно, но ставить пока не буду

наверно из-за этого "Бинирные пакеты" :)

l-xoid ★★★★★ ()

Re: QBookShelf 1.0pre1 релиз!

А она умеет показывать текст в виде обычной книги a-la TOM Reader? Или еще не научилась? А то я задолбался книжки через wine читать...

anonymous ()

Re: QBookShelf 1.0pre1 релиз!

прикрутите пожалуйста к нему configure или Makefile который можно обычным make обработать. а то на эту программу даже и взглянуть не получается

anonymous ()

Re: QBookShelf 1.0pre1 релиз!

Эх, сделайте категоризацию нормальную и поддержку pdf/chm - для девелоперов самое то будет, чтобы работать со своей коллекцией (как у меня - 4 гига, задолбался уже)

daebear ()
Ответ на: Re: QBookShelf 1.0pre1 релиз! от anonymous

Re: Re: QBookShelf 1.0pre1 релиз!

ещё отсутствует заявленый бинарный пакет для слаки. и хорошо если бы скриншотов бы кто-нибудь напарил.

anonymous ()

Re: QBookShelf 1.0pre1 релиз!

Здоровско. Жаль только, что Qt. Действительно хоца на скриншоты посмотреть. И еще вопрос (ну, из области извращений, правда) - не думали про xosd? Чтобы проецировать текст на кусок экрана "поверх всего"?

svu ★★★★★ ()
Ответ на: Re: Re: Re: QBookShelf 1.0pre1 релиз! от Severus_Zley

Re: Re: Re: Re: QBookShelf 1.0pre1 релиз!

Я то догадался, что надо скрипт использовать, но в docs/INSTALL написано иное.

А баг с уменьшением действительно есть. К тому же, он не убирается после открытия нового документа. Только рестарт проги помогает.

qt-3.3.2
wv-1.0.0
enca-1.0

Selecter ★★★★ ()

Re: QBookShelf 1.0pre1 релиз!

Хочешь, а прикручу (попробую по крайней мере) нормальный configure/Makefile ?

svyatogor ★★★★★ ()
Ответ на: Re: QBookShelf 1.0pre1 релиз! от o1o

Re: Re: QBookShelf 1.0pre1 релиз!

подозреваю, что вещь хорошая...пойду поставлю QT...гляну

geek ★★★ ()

Re: QBookShelf 1.0pre1 релиз!

может стоит на главной странице показывать только первый абзац новости или что-то в этом роде? а то вообще беспердел

anonymous ()
Ответ на: Re: Re: QBookShelf 1.0pre1 релиз! от anonymous

Re: Re: Re: QBookShelf 1.0pre1 релиз!

Да, а еще есть беда по имени дежавю. Ее тоже хорошо бы, до кучи

svu ★★★★★ ()
Ответ на: Re: QBookShelf 1.0pre1 релиз! от geek

Re: Re: QBookShelf 1.0pre1 релиз!

qt-devel содержит файлы, необходимые для разработки приложений с использованием Qt GUI: заголовочные файлы, moc, man-pages, html документацию и примеры.

anonymous ()

Re: QBookShelf 1.0pre1 релиз!

Кто может помочь с разразработкой,
или у кого предложения, вопросы - пишите на be AT tut.by

Severus_Zley ()

Re: QBookShelf 1.0pre1 релиз!

Лучше бы поддержку FB2 ввели. А то до сих пор под Linux нет FB2-читалки... :-/

KRoN73 ★★★★★ ()

Re: QBookShelf 1.0pre1 релиз!

Хм.. из-за одной проги qt держать как-то нехочется. Уж лучше буду по старинке книжки less'ом читать :)

А на самом деле, книжки должны быть в печатном виде. :-)

human0id ★★★ ()
Ответ на: Re: Re: Re: QBookShelf 1.0pre1 релиз! от geek

Re: Re: Re: Re: QBookShelf 1.0pre1 релиз!

открыл todo и первые три буквы каждой строчки почему-то зеленые., а нет, только до There are diff

no1sm ★★ ()

Re: QBookShelf 1.0pre1 релиз!

не это точно крутая прога.

зависимости:

qt-3.2.2-2.src.rpm - 14Mb

cups-1.1.20-6.src.rpm - 4Mb

dbus-0.20.4-1.src.rpm - 1,2Mb

mysql-3.23.58-9.src.rpm - 12Mb

postgresql-7.4.2-1.src.rpm - 11Mb

unixODBC-2.2.8-5.src.rpm - 2Mb

чичас собираются cups и dbus =)

geek ★★★ ()
Ответ на: Re: Re: QBookShelf 1.0pre1 релиз! от svu

Re: Re: Re: QBookShelf 1.0pre1 релиз!

>Это где-то очень крутой src.rpm для qt сделан...

Ты знал =)

geek ★★★ ()
Ответ на: Re: Re: QBookShelf 1.0pre1 релиз! от Severus_Zley

Re: Re: Re: QBookShelf 1.0pre1 релиз!

>>Поподробнее нельзя ли, а то до скрина вашего не достучаться...

скрин на другую машину закинул: http://193.124.215.97/~danil/qbs.jpg Это лучше увидеть.

anonymous ()
Ответ на: Re: QBookShelf 1.0pre1 релиз! от KRoN73

Re: Re: QBookShelf 1.0pre1 релиз!

>Лучше бы поддержку FB2 ввели

В натуре, FB2 - рулит.

hooj ★★ ()

Re: QBookShelf 1.0pre1 релиз!

добрался до unixODBC-devel (спрашивается, а нафиг тогда требовались mysql-devel и postgresql-devel?) и тут выяснил, что нужны ещё и kdelibs-devel

плюнул. Эта прога мне не по зубам. Буду по старинке читать - по бумажке =)

geek ★★★ ()
Ответ на: Re: QBookShelf 1.0pre1 релиз! от geek

Re: Re: QBookShelf 1.0pre1 релиз!

Есть мысля - поставить qt в форме i386.rpm. Или это неспортивно? Да, а такие зависимости я где-то видел. Это кто-то был сильно пьян...:)

svu ★★★★★ ()
Ответ на: Re: Re: QBookShelf 1.0pre1 релиз! от svu

Re: Re: Re: QBookShelf 1.0pre1 релиз!

Это, конечно, в том случае, когда ломает покорежить qt.spec на предмет выкидывания unixodbc...

svu ★★★★★ ()
Ответ на: Re: QBookShelf 1.0pre1 релиз! от geek

Re: Re: QBookShelf 1.0pre1 релиз!

> добрался до unixODBC-devel (спрашивается, а нафиг тогда требовались
> mysql-devel и postgresql-devel?) и тут выяснил, что нужны ещё и
> kdelibs-devel. плюнул. Эта прога мне не по зубам

/me бъется в истерике :-) Давно так не веселился :-)

Автору: все там были :-)

no-dashi ★★★★★ ()

Re: QBookShelf 1.0pre1 релиз!

А где скриншоты?

Toster ()
Ответ на: Re: Re: QBookShelf 1.0pre1 релиз! от svu

Re: Re: Re: QBookShelf 1.0pre1 релиз!

>Есть мысля - поставить qt в форме i386.rpm. Или это неспортивно? Да, а такие зависимости я где-то видел. Это кто-то был сильно пьян...:)

Я бы сказал, этот кто-то был без сознания =)

geek ★★★ ()
Ответ на: Re: Re: Re: Re: QBookShelf 1.0pre1 релиз! от Severus_Zley

Re: Re: Re: Re: Re: QBookShelf 1.0pre1 релиз!

Большое спасиба! вроде неплохо работает, но 1)изменяю размер шрифта, открываю и закрываю диалог настройки, размер шрифта возвращается на дефолтный.2)Позиция файла не всегда правильно сохраняется.3)Былобы неплохо автоматически запоминать размер шрифта последнего открытого файла.

Valerius ★★ ()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.